Častá chyba:
Learners sometimes confuse 'assumption' with 'guess'. A guess is often less certain and may not be based on reasoning, while an assumption is usually a starting point for thinking or action.

Častá chyba:
Learners may confuse this with 'acceptance'. 'Assumption' here emphasizes the start of holding a role, while 'acceptance' focuses on agreeing to take it.
